Unit I

RAILWAY ENGINEERING 9
Introduction of Railway Engineering: Permanent way. Curves, super-elevation, negative superelevation, transition curve, grade compensation on curves. Railway operation 6 control -points and crossings turn-out. Signaling and interlocking. Centralized traffic control.Railway accidents & safety. Rapid transit railways – types, merits & demerits..

Unit II

HIGHWAY ENGINEERING 9
Introduction of Highway Engineering: Classification of highways and urban road patterns. Typical cross section of roads.Factors controlling the alignment of roads. Basic geometric design – stopping and overtaking sight distances.

Unit IV

HARBOUR AND DOCK ENGINEERING 9
Introduction of Harbour& Dock Engineering: Water transportation, classification of harbours, accessibility and size, ports, Indian ports. Layout of ports, breakwater, facilities (in brief) for docking, repair, approach, loading and unloading, storing and guiding.

Unit V

AIR TRANSPORTATION ENGINEERING
Classification of air transportation, Types of air craft engines – Propellants-feeding systems -Ignition and combustion – Theory of rocket propulsion -Applications -Air way accidents & safety

Reference Books:

  1. Chandra, S. &Agarwal, M. M. “Railway Engineering”. Oxford University Press, New Delhi,2007
  2. Khanna, S. K. and Justo, C. E. G.,”Highway Engineering” (9th ed).Nem Chand & Brothers, NewDelhi,2001.
  3. GeethamTiwari& Dinesh Mohan,”Transport Planning & Traffic safety”
  4. Srinivasan, R.,”Harbour, Dock and Tunnel Engineering”. Charotar Publishing House Pvt. Ltd, Anand,2013.
  5. Kadiyali, L. R.,”Traffic Engineering and Transport Planning”, Khanna Publishers, New Delhi,2004
